The player teams consist of 8 characters, plus the ability to hire a mercenary and bot for a mission (so max 10 units) being
Leader and 2IC, specialists and recruits. Abilities and traits differ across these classes, and you allocate skill points as you see fit.


However the NPC side is determined by the various charts used. There are three charts being "The Vigilant" - think SW Empire/Republic - "The Wilderness" think pirates, wastelanders and animals - and "The Urban"

NPC numbers are determined by how many spawn of each type, and so more than 8 is very likely in most cases, but of differing classes (there are 16 different types of NPC - troopers, mechs, bots, pirates, scavengers and animals etc).

While the game can be played co-op of H2H its design is very much to allow strong solo play, which is perhaps where its strengths lay.

Andy, the game is set up on the assumption that your team are a spaceship crew or similar rather than a space marine patrol. Think The Expanse, Firefly, Killjoys, Dark Matter and the like.

Not to say that you couldn't have marines but they'd be very powerful if specced like their Grimdark equivalents. You'd generate more npc enemies if playing solo or co-op.

I see no problem with fielding fewer than 8 figures (10 if you have a bot and a mercenary specialist) if they were better armed/ armoured/ skilled than usual but the game isn't designed for that.

Goblins would be far easier as they are probably not too different from basic humans in ability.

As to more and less powerful team members, it is likely that you will have at least some recruits alongside your specialists. Each specialist character is going to have their own roles, recruits are your grunts.
